Mohammed Rayd Ullah has been competing for 11 months. His best event is the 3×3: a personal-best single of 9.41, set at Twist 'n Turn Hyd Open 2026, puts him in the top 5.9% of the 284,439 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 617th in India. Until February 2008, no official 3×3 solve in the world had been that fast. Across 4 competitions since September 2025, he has put 116 official solves on the record across six events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 16% around a typical one, an early reading from 8 counted rounds. His 3×3 best has come down from 11.89 in September 2025 to 9.41, a 21% improvement. Mohammed has entered four competitions, more competitions than 78% of everyone who has ever competed.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· top X% compares against everyone ever ranked in that event, which is fairer than raw rank because event pools differ tenfold.
